Parent Company
A corporation that owns enough voting stock in another corporation to control its management and operations.
Amortization
The process of gradually writing off the initial cost of an asset over its useful life.
Bond Investment
An investment in debt securities issued by corporations or governments to finance their operations.
Other Comprehensive Income
Other Comprehensive Income represents revenues, expenses, gains, and losses not included in net income, and reflects changes in equity during a period except those resulting from investments by and distributions to owners.
